DTS is an internal consultant scheduling system as well as a skill repository. It is currently being augmented to track the recruiting process. It eventually will also record actual hours worked for billing.
The database is small (10MB), but the reports are large and spreadsheet-like which is challenging interms of performance and presentation.
It is a critical system at RoseRyan and was previously implemented in Lotus Notes Domino and Tomcat with a Velocity front end.
Architecture description
Tomcat and MySQL running on an Ubuntu server. After some initial memory issues it has been rock solid.


Comments (0)